Donegal 0-10 Monaghan 1-12
These two. It’s the usual story. Monaghan and Donegal are the couple down the local every Friday night, rowing like blazes and not giving a toss as to who’s hearing.
Just when Donegal thought they were getting their act together – beating the All-Ireland champions, Michael Murphy back in the county colours – up pop Monaghan to remind them that it’s a harsh world and there is no love.
Cue 70 minutes of death metal, a vintage show by the Kierans – Duffy and Hughes – and a rainbow appearing over Ballybofey just as the home team lost their first league game in a dozen years at MacCumhaill Park.
